Distribution of Lawyers

The distribution of lawyers across the globe is far from uniform. Some countries, particularly those with large populations and advanced economies, boast a high concentration of legal professionals. For instance, the United States, with its robust legal system and a large, diverse population, has a substantial number of lawyers.

In contrast, countries with smaller populations and less developed economies may have fewer lawyers per capita. This variation is not merely a matter of population size but also reflects the demand for legal services in different societies.

GDP per Capita and Lawyer Population

There is a strong correlation between a country’s GDP per capita and the number of lawyers per capita. Countries with higher GDP per capita tend to have a greater concentration of lawyers. This is because economic development often leads to a more complex legal landscape, with increased demand for legal services in areas such as corporate law, finance, and intellectual property.

However, there are exceptions to this correlation, such as countries with highly specialized legal professions or those with a strong emphasis on public interest law.

Legal System Variations

The legal systems of different countries have a profound impact on the role and responsibilities of lawyers. Common law, civil law, and mixed systems each have their own unique characteristics that shape the lawyer-client relationship and the legal profession as a whole.

Lawyer-Client Relationship

  • Common Law:In common law systems, lawyers play a more adversarial role, advocating for their clients’ interests in court proceedings. The lawyer-client relationship is characterized by a strong emphasis on confidentiality and client autonomy.
  • Civil Law:In civil law systems, lawyers often act as legal advisors and advocates for their clients, but their role is less adversarial. The lawyer-client relationship is more focused on providing legal guidance and representing clients in legal proceedings.
  • Mixed Systems:Mixed systems combine elements of both common law and civil law, resulting in a unique blend of legal practices and traditions. The role of lawyers in mixed systems can vary depending on the specific elements of each system.

Lawyers play a vital role in society by upholding the rule of law, protecting individual rights, and ensuring fairness and justice. They advise clients on legal matters, represent them in court, and advocate for their interests.

What are the different types of legal systems in the world?

The major legal systems in the world include common law, civil law, and mixed systems. Common law systems are based on precedent, while civil law systems rely on codified statutes. Mixed systems combine elements of both common law and civil law.
